About Romans
Romans, founded in Bracknell in 1987, are one of the largest and most respected property groups in south-east England. In 2016 we joined forces with our sister company Leaders, and since then more brands have joined forces with us so now we have a combined UK network of over 215 estate and letting agencies, known as LRG.
LRG are an award-winning national property company, who are going through exciting periods of growth and offer tailored training and development programmes at all levels. With over 200 branches across England and Wales we have a reputation for perfection and delivering an outstanding customer experience. Job Summary and Key Responsibilities
Reporting to the Team Manager/Head of Centre, Romans are seeking a Property Manager to join our dedicated and dynamic team based in Camberley. As a Property Manager, experience is beneficial but not essential. You will play a pivotal role in ensuring our customers receive the highest level of service and support. You will act as a point of contact for our tenants and landlords, assisting them with inquiries, booking appointments and ensuring a smooth process throughout the tenancy from beginning to end.
Key Responsibilities
- Provide excellent levels of both telephone and written communication for the duration of the tenancy
- Accept and understand tenants maintenance requirements, providing a triage service to try to resolve issues
- If unable to resolve, communicate this to the landlord with a solution and arrange works with a dedicated contractor
- Update all parties on a regular basis by phone, email or text and log notes
- Make regular wellbeing calls to the landlord
- Work with the property management team to ensure all works are completed and invoiced within 21 days and update customers on progress
- Ensure that all mandatory compliance/legislation is in place on all properties, and follow company process if not
- Work with the Property Visit Clerks to ensure inspections are completed and that landlords and tenants are fully communicated to in line with company policy
- Place calls to all managed landlords and tenants 2 weeks prior to vacation to ensure they understand the check-out process and time frames
- Deal with non-managed deposits who are part of the No Deposit Scheme
- Ensure the check-out process is followed and communication is sent out within company process via the Depositary site
- Collaborate with team leaders, head of centres and branch network to understand reasons for any lost units
- Maintain high levels of communication to internal and external customers
